Output 576966d40ed3852cad39a1706075d4b150855a37da25e08f8e4b4a43542071ec:26

value
289490
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5961054b2e589e30e20e7f3b7101751ec8615f7e OP_EQUALVERIFY OP_CHECKSIG
address
199bNBtqftWYHPY67vXobA8Hs6EEgDBzeH
transaction
576966d40ed3852cad39a1706075d4b150855a37da25e08f8e4b4a43542071ec
spent
true